Home mortgage lenders think about not simply your credit however likewise your debt-to-income ratio when you make an application for a loan. This ratio compares overall debt payments to your gross month-to-month income. For example, if your gross month-to-month income is $4,000, your mortgage will cost $1,000 month-to-month and all other debts add up to $500, your Go here debt-to-income ratio is $1,500/$ 4,000 or 37.
Normally, your debt-to-income ratio can't exceed 43% to get approved for a mortgage, although many loan providers prefer a lower ratio (what is the current variable rate for mortgages). If you owe a lot of cash, you're going to have to pay for a few of it to get approved for a loan to buy a house. Paying down debt also assists enhance your credit, which allows you to get approved for a better home loan rate and lower regular monthly payments and interest.

Some loan providers need an escrow account and some let the property owner pay their insurance and taxes straight.

Each lender/financial institution has their own home loan items, however they usually fall into these categories: Fixed-rate home mortgage Rates of interest stays the very same for the life of the loan providing you with a steady and foreseeable month-to-month payment. Variable-rate mortgage Rates of interest is flexible and based on adjustmentseither on specific dates (3-, 5-, 7-year modifications) or based on market conditions.
Federal government guaranteed mortgages Both the Federal Real Estate Administration (FHA) and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) offer loans to assist house owners with income limitations or those who are currently in the military or a veteran respectively. Usually these loans have lower deposit requirements and less limiting qualifying guidelines, however they do need you to fulfill particular requirements.
